😐A single person spends $852 per month in Chiang Mai vs $447 in Sargodha, rent included.
😐A couple spends around $1,354 per month in Chiang Mai vs $667 in Sargodha, rent included.
😐A family of three spends $1,857 per month in Chiang Mai vs $887 in Sargodha, rent included.
😐Chiang Mai costs about 91% more than Sargodha,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.
📊Both Chiang Mai and Sargodha are more affordable than the global median – Chiang Mai36% lower, Sargodha67% lower.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A central one-bedroom costs $424 in Chiang Mai versus $76.6 in Sargodha.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
💰Salaries run about 249% higher in Chiang Mai,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$19.00 in Chiang Mai versus $14.00 in Sargodha.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$243 vs $84.0 – making Sargodha the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
